in May and gamely packed up
and moved to San Juan last sum-
mer, arriving July 10, one day af-
ter Hurricane Bertha struck.
Despite hurricanes — Bertha
was soon followed by Hortense —
and adjustments to a very big
move, Rabbi Friedman is thrilled
with her first rabbinic position.
"It's a wonderful shidduch,"
she says of the match between an
unusual congregation and an ea-
ger rabbi.
She was selected after a care-
ful screening process that includ-
ed a full weekend spent with the
congregation in April, after which
she was offered the position.
Because it meant a big move
— and the need to live tem-
porarily apart from her husband,
Stanley, an English teacher in
Westfield — she talked it over at
length with her husband and her
adult sons, Rami, 24, and Ilan,
21. "And the more we thought
about it, the more enthusiastic
we were," says Rabbi Friedman.
Her congregants are a diverse
group. One third are Puerto Ri-
cans who are married to "conti-
nentals," the term used for those

ust like many rabbinical
students, Susan Friedman
wanted her first rabbinical
assignment to be challeng-
ing and special. But she never
imagined just how unusual it
would be.
On January 31, Rabbi Fried-
man of Westfield, N.J., was in-
stalled as the first full-time rabbi
of a small Reform congregation
far from home — on a tropical is-
land in the Caribbean.
She's now rabbi of Temple
Beth Shalom in San Juan, Puer-
to Rico. It's one of only two Re-
form congregations in the
Caribbean, the other being in
nearby St. Thomas in the U.S.
Virgin Islands.
Meeting the rabbi and visiting
this small but flourishing con-
gregation was one highlight of a
recent trip to San Juan.
From earlier visits, I was al-
ready acquainted with Beth
Shalom and its dedicated con-
gregation. They had transformed
a former run-down bar, the Ninth
Inning Bar, into a simple but
beautiful sanctuary, where they
worship every Friday evening—
